  4. 2017 was a record year for hacks of personal customer details. These breaches give fraudsters access to our identities including the answers to those annoying security questions. One thing the fraudsters can’t do much with? Voice data. And that is why banks and telcos are increasingly replacing security questions with biometrics.

  9. There is an entire world of customer success that has blown up in the past few years. These ideas have existed for a while, but not to the extent that they do now. The change has come from their increasing level of importance. In a world where software review sites are growing, products are becoming more accountable. The value of keeping customers happy has extended beyond signed contracts. Unhappy customers can give your service a negative review and spread the word, which can be detrimental. In order to make sure that customers are happy, you have to ask the right questions and keep track of the answers.
